Brief summary
This randomized phase III trial studies how well a multimedia self-management intervention works in preparing family caregivers and patients with stage I-III lung cancer for lung cancer surgery. The multimedia self-management intervention, Preparing for your Lung Cancer Surgery, is a nurse-led, caregiver-based, multimedia intervention that may improve patient recovery after surgery, lower caregiving burden, and improve distress and quality of life.
Detailed description
PRIMARY OBJECTIVES: I. Test the effects of the multimedia self-management (MSM) intervention on family caregivers (FCG) outcomes and cancer support services use at discharge and 3-month post-discharge, comparing intervention and attention control groups. II. Test the effects of the MSM intervention on patient outcomes and healthcare resource use at discharge and 3-months post-discharge, comparing intervention and attention control groups. III. Test the effects of the MSM intervention on outcome mediators at discharge and 3-months post-discharge, comparing intervention and attention control groups. SECONDARY OBJECTIVES: I. Explore moderators (age, sex, marital status, caregiver relationship to patient, caregiver employment status, co-morbidities) of FCG and patient outcomes and reciprocal relationships. II. Determine, through exit interviews, participant's experience with the MSM intervention. OUTLINE: Patients are randomized to 1 of 2 groups. GROUP I: Patients and FCGs receive the MSM intervention consisting of videos, a handbook, and research nurse coaching over 40-60 minutes, approximately 3-7 days before surgery and within 24 hours of planned discharge. Patients and FCGs also receive research nurse support by telephone (separate sessions for FCGs and patients) over 20-30 minutes at 2 and 7 days, and 2 months post-discharge. GROUP II: Patients and FCGs receive attention control intervention consisting of videos (American Cancer Society video on "Clinical Trials"), American Cancer Society print materials, and assistance from a clinical research associate (CRA) approximately 3-7 days before surgery and within 24 hours of planned discharge. Patients and FCGs also receive assistance from CRAs via telephone calls at 2 and 7 days, and 2 months post-discharge.

Eligibility
Inclusion criteria
Family Caregiver Inclusion Criteria: * A family member or friend identified by the patient as being the primary care provider before and after surgery * A patient/care recipient enrolled in the study * Age 21 years or older * Able to read or understand English Patient Inclusion Criteria: * Diagnosis of Stage I-III non-small cell lung cancer * Scheduled to undergo surgery for treatment * A family caregiver enrolled in the study * Age 21 years or older * Able to read or understand English.

Participant flow
Recruitment details
542 participants (342 patients, 200 caregivers) were assessed for study eligibility. After 162 participants were excluded for various reasons - not meeting inclusion criteria (n= 91), declined to participate (n= 48), other/unknown reasons (n= 3), late ineligibility (n= 20), 380 participants (190 dyads - 190 patients, 190 caregivers) were randomized.

Outcome results
Change in Caregiving Burden (as Measured by the Montgomery Borgatta Caregiver Burden Scale)
Mean caregiver burden scores from baseline to 3 months post-discharge were calculated. A linear mixed-effects model was used to assess differences in burden between the intervention and control arm over time. The model included treatment arm, time, and the interaction between treatment arm and time as effects. Total burden score is calculated by summing items from 3 subscales: objective burden, subjective burden & demand burden. Score range: 14-70. Higher score means worse outcome.
Time frame: Outcomes are measured at baseline, 1 month, and 3 months post-discharge. Absolute values are reported at each timeframe.
Population: Due to attrition in the study, the number of family caregivers assessed at baseline differs from the number of family caregivers analyzed during follow-up.
| Arm | Measure | Group | Value (MEAN) |
|---|---|---|---|
| Group I (MSM Intervention) | Change in Caregiving Burden (as Measured by the Montgomery Borgatta Caregiver Burden Scale) | Baseline | 44.68 score on a scale |
| Group I (MSM Intervention) | Change in Caregiving Burden (as Measured by the Montgomery Borgatta Caregiver Burden Scale) | 1 month post-discharge | 42.19 score on a scale |
| Group I (MSM Intervention) | Change in Caregiving Burden (as Measured by the Montgomery Borgatta Caregiver Burden Scale) | 3 months post-discharge | 40.45 score on a scale |
| Group II (Attention Control) | Change in Caregiving Burden (as Measured by the Montgomery Borgatta Caregiver Burden Scale) | Baseline | 44.56 score on a scale |
| Group II (Attention Control) | Change in Caregiving Burden (as Measured by the Montgomery Borgatta Caregiver Burden Scale) | 1 month post-discharge | 44.73 score on a scale |
| Group II (Attention Control) | Change in Caregiving Burden (as Measured by the Montgomery Borgatta Caregiver Burden Scale) | 3 months post-discharge | 42.00 score on a scale |
